A septic inspection is a comprehensive checkup of your wastewater system. The technician looks for signs of leaks, checks the liquid levels, and observes the drain field to ensure it is absorbing water correctly. It is a smart move before real estate closings or if you have lived in your home for several years without service. Factors like permit requirements affect the cost. Summer often means more houseguests and increased water usage, which puts extra demand on your septic tank. With more showers and laundry loads, it is easier for a tank to reach capacity. If you have guests coming over, consider a pump-out beforehand to avoid an inconvenient backup during your family gatherings.

For septic systems in Los Angeles, it's best to use septic-safe toilet paper. This type of paper is designed to break down quickly in the tank, preventing clogs. Avoid using excessive amounts of any toilet paper, even septic-safe varieties. Additionally, refrain from flushing anything other than human waste and toilet paper. This simple practice helps maintain the health of your septic system.
Several signs point to the need for septic repair in Los Angeles. These include persistent sewage odors around your tank or drain field, unusually lush or bare patches in your yard, and slow-draining sinks or toilets. You might also notice wastewater backing up into your home. If you observe any of these issues, it's time to call for a professional inspection and potential repairs to your Los Angeles septic system.
Septic tank maintenance in Los Angeles, primarily pumping, is typically recommended every 3 to 5 years. However, this frequency can vary based on your household size and water usage. A licensed professional can inspect your tank during a service call and advise on the best schedule for your specific needs. Regular maintenance is key to preventing costly breakdowns and ensuring your system operates efficiently.
A septic tank is a buried, watertight container holding wastewater from your home. Solids settle to the bottom, forming sludge, while lighter materials like grease float to the top as scum. Bacteria in the tank begin to break down the waste. The liquid effluent then flows out to a drain field for further treatment in the soil. This process effectively treats household wastewater.
